WebApr 24, 2024 · Florida Coontie has been known by several botanical names, including Zamia pumila, Zamia floridana, and Zamia silvicola, and a number of varietal names. These entities differ largely in minor features of the leaflets and in the size of the female cones. All forms of the plant, regardless of name, are considered rare. Related Rare Species. None ... Webfemale plant when the cone begins to de-compose. Mature seeds have a fleshy, red coat, the removal of which facilitates ger-mination (Smith 1978a). Eckenwalder (1980b) observed mockingbirds feeding on the seed coat of Zamia furfuracea growing at the Fairchild Tropical Gardens in Florida and suggested that birds may disperse Zamia
